Subject: [PATCH v2 1/3] scsi: hisi_sas: Reduce some indirection in v3 hw driver

Sometimes local functions are called indirectly from the hw driver, which
only makes the code harder to follow. Remove these.

Method .hw_init is only called from platform driver probe, which is not
relevant, so don't set this either.
